How to set environment variables in Python Stack Overflow

20 Answers Sorted by 1475 Environment variables must be strings so use import os os environ DEBUSSY 1 to set the variable DEBUSSY to the string 1 To access this variable later simply use print os environ DEBUSSY

Replace environment variables in a file with their actual values , 13 Answers Sorted by 165 You could use envsubst part of gnu gettext envsubst infile will replace the environment variables in your file with their corresponding value The variable names must consist solely of alphanumeric or underscore ASCII characters not start with a digit and be nonempty otherwise such a variable reference is ignored

Python Env Vars How to Get an Environment Variable in Python

Python Env Vars How to Get an Environment Variable in Python, In Python you can access and manipulate environment variables using the os module This module provides functions and dictionaries to interact with the operating system including the ability to retrieve the values of environment variables set new variables or modify existing ones How to Access Environment Variables
